Chapter 3 Abnormal Affairs Administration Bureau

Xing Yun slowly walked forward and attached the summoner in his hand to it.

In the blink of an eye, the energy cube was sucked into the summoner.

After absorbing the energy, Xing Yun put the summoner in his pocket and walked outside.

Inside the summoner.

"First absorption of alien beast energy: +17 upgrade points"

"Wow, so much added." Lu Zhuo's consciousness changed from a lounging position to standing up and looking at the panel.

"Summoning System"

"Host: Lu Zhuo"

Level: 1

"Form: Armor Summoner"

Summoner: Xing Yun

"Summoner compatibility: (3/10)"

"Required for the next level: (17.05/100)"

Looking at the panel, Lu Zhuo calculated in his mind: "If every monster adds this much, then I only need to fight about six more times to level up."

I wonder what it will be like to upgrade to level two; I'm kind of looking forward to it.

outside.

Xing Yun, head down, touched the wound on his right shoulder with his left hand and limped out of the ironworks factory gate.

The thoughts about the alien beasts kept replaying in his mind.

The monsters called alien beasts are creatures that have existed since ancient times.

According to ancient records, these strange beasts arose from a war between ancient gods.

Many gods died, and their resentment and blood were spilled onto the earth, polluting humanity.

The alien beasts are the products of animals coming into contact with these things.

They are bloodthirsty by nature, have volatile and unpredictable tempers, and are corrupted by the consciousness of the gods, causing them to kill every human they see.

However, the gods who survived bestowed blessings upon humanity to protect them, granting extraordinary powers to some people with special constitutions, enabling them to fight against the alien beasts.

These lucky individuals are also called Awakeners.

In modern times, they have even secretly established organizations such as the Bureau of Abnormal Affairs, which specifically recruit awakened individuals to fight against alien monsters.

Xing Yun looked up at the gate. She didn't know when, but the surrounding environment was like a foggy day, and she couldn't see anything beyond five meters.

"What's going on?!" Xing Yun stared wide-eyed, turning his head in disbelief to look at the thick fog around him.

He was certain that it was sunny outside just a moment ago, but now it was shrouded in thick fog.

Looking down from above, you can see that the entire ironworks is covered by a huge semi-circular dome.

The entire cover resembled clumps of mist piled together. The mist, which would normally disperse, was now restrained by some mysterious force, forming a smooth surface on the outer shell.

Xing Yun was completely unaware of the situation outside. His mind was racing as he tried to find a way to deal with the situation from his memories.

But the more Xing Yun thought about it, the more chaotic her mind became, as if someone was stirring it wildly with a stick.

Xing Yun knew he couldn't just sit and wait to die, so he walked towards the factory gate he remembered, trying to leave.

But with each step he took, his vision became a little blurrier, until after walking a dozen steps, he could no longer hold on and collapsed to the ground.

Looking at the workers who had collapsed on the ground around him, Li Rui came to his senses and looked at the energy detector in his hand. Then he turned to Zhou Hai beside him with a serious expression and said.

"Captain, we're too late. Most of the energy of the alien beasts inside has already dissipated."

Zhou Hai turned to look at Li Rui, a young man who had only joined the Bureau of Abnormal Affairs a few weeks ago.

He was a rare technical talent. He had a cylindrical tool bag hanging horizontally on his waist. The tool bag was about half a person's height when it stood upright, but Li Rui carried it as if nothing was wrong.

However, they have only conducted a few operations and clearly lack experience.

Zhou Hai pushed his sunglasses up over his hair, didn't respond to Li Rui, looked at the steel plant in front of him, and waved to signal the start of the operation.

A team of four entered the steel mill.

Before even entering the ironworks, they could see that the various machines inside were almost paralyzed, and in some places molten iron was constantly flowing out, dripping onto the ground and sparking before quickly solidifying.

As they entered, the stench of blood and the smell of burnt rubber, mixed with the heat, assaulted their nostrils.

Except for Zhou Hai, who remained calm, the others held their breath to prevent the stench from entering their nostrils.

Zhou Hai scanned the ironworks with the sharp eyes of an eagle, searching for any trace of the monster.

Several steel pipes, half melted, were scattered on the ground around them.

Clumps of dark powder suddenly appeared on the ground.

As Zhou Hai walked forward, he observed his surroundings and soon noticed several unusual places.

He stepped over a clump of carbonized black powder on the ground and came to the furnace.

The molten iron flowing from the hole in the furnace had cooled and solidified. Zhou Hai looked at the hole in the furnace and glanced at the white cross-shaped knife marks on the huge black stone pillar next to him.

The other team members followed Zhou Hai's gaze and also saw the abrupt white cross-shaped knife mark.

"Someone is fighting the Melting Monster here."

Li Rui exclaimed in surprise. After a period of detection, the data on the screen of the energy detector in his hand finally appeared.

Zhou Hai turned to look at the energy detector in Li Rui's hand and asked, "What was the result?"

Li Rui adjusted his slipping glasses with his right hand and unconsciously swallowed.

"Energy analysis shows that there are residual fire and metal energy here, and the metal energy is stronger than the fire energy."

Judging from the traces at the scene, the fire-attribute energy corresponds to the melting monster that appeared last night, while the origin of the metal-attribute energy is unknown.

"So the Awakened Ones have dealt with the alien beasts here before we have?" Female team member Chen Wan said coldly.

"That seems to be the case, but we didn't detect any other Awakened's energy outside just now." Li Rui kept pressing the flat-shaped detector to retrieve data.

Zhou Hai walked to the stone pillar and touched the rice-shaped marks on it.

Even without energy support, Zhou Hai could still feel a slight tingling sensation from his fingertips.

That's sword energy!

These two words came to Zhou Hai's mind. As far as he knew, there was no civilian awakening in Shenhui County who could achieve this level of awareness.

New Awakeners?

Do not!

Zhou Hai immediately rejected this idea, even if he had awakened the relevant abilities, it would be impossible to achieve such a level in a short period of time.

If you want the remaining energy to still have power, your strength must reach level C or above.

Most awakened individuals in the general population are at a low level, around E-rank, and their strength is only slightly stronger than that of ordinary people, with some supernatural abilities.

There is only one explanation: an unregistered high-level awakened individual secretly arrived in Shenhui County.

Zhou Hai snapped out of his daze and turned around. At that moment, several team members had finished taking samples on site and were looking at him.

"Operation complete. After altering the memories of the surrounding workers, remove the fog cover," Zhou Hai instructed.

"Yes." Li Rui lowered his head, put the energy detector back into the tool bag hanging on his waist, and rummaged around for a while before taking out a glass ball.

A wisp of white gas tinged with pink occasionally escaped from inside the glass sphere, making it look like a dream, incredibly dreamlike.

Li Rui held the glass ball in both hands, closed his eyes, and an invisible energy began to spread from the glass ball until it filled the entire area shrouded in mist.

Zhou Hai and the others watched Li Rui operate quietly. Modifying memories was no simple matter. It wasn't just about injecting energy into the Dream Smoke Ball, which could modify memories.

They also need to use their own will to control the energy emitted by the Dream Smoke Ball, precisely introduce it into the minds of every ordinary person present, and then manipulate and modify their memories.

This means that the more people whose memories need to be altered, the more difficult it becomes.

The energy emitted by the Dream Smoke Ball itself has a hallucinogenic effect. Zhou Hai and the others are all awakened beings, and their consciousnesses have evolved to be immune to this effect.

Therefore, if Li Rui makes a mistake, they will intervene immediately.

Fortunately, Li Rui's operation was flawless, and he successfully altered the memories of the ordinary people around him.

They would only remember that one of the ironworks buildings collapsed due to quality issues, while completely forgetting about the Otherworldly demons.

"Retreat." Seeing that Li Rui had opened his eyes and returned to normal, Zhou Hai waved his hand and the four of them walked outside.

The black official car started and drove away from the ironworks before sunset.

The mist that had enveloped the ironworks dispersed and disappeared as they left.
